- What protecting the mindset looks like in the days of social media, low playing time, a bad coach etc…
- The personal tools I use to manage the pressure of sport
- How I create space to hear God’s voice in a busy, high-performance world
- A vulnerable moment when I found myself in a dark place — and how faith helped me turn it around
- The origin story of Pro Ball Buddy (which might actually surprise you) and what I see myself doing 10 years from now.
